Step-by-step explanation:

The sum of complementary angles is 90°. If we let s and y represent m∠S and m∠Y, respectively, the angle measures in degrees satisfy ...

  s + y = 90

  (4y -110) +y = 90 . . . . . . . . substitute for s

  5y = 200 . . . . . . . . . add 110

  y = 40 . . . . . . . divide by 5

The measure of angle Y is 40°.

The slope of the line whose equation is 3x - 2y = 4 is 2/3 3/2 -2
7nadin3 [17]

Answer:

3/2

Step-by-step explanation:

The equation 3x-2y=4 can be written in the form of y=mx+c where m is the slope and c is the y intercept.

Therefore

2y=3x-4 and dividing both sides by 2 to have y at the LHS

y=3/2x-2

Therefore, 3/2 represents the gradient/slope

What is the slope between the points (5,-4) and (-3,4) <br> -1<br> 4<br> 0<br> 1
kumpel [21]

Answer:

The answer is -1.

Step-by-step explanation:

You have to apply gradient formula :

m =  \frac{y2 - y1}{x2 - x1}

So you will have to substitute the coordinates into the equation. Let (x1,y1) be (-3,4) and (x2,y2) be (5,-4) :

m =  \frac{ - 4 - 4}{5 - ( - 3)}

m =  \frac{ - 8}{8}

m =  - 1
